Given our rural roads and winter weather, common issues for local Hondas include premature brake wear from gravel/dust, suspension components affected by potholes, and corrosion from road salt. Models like the CR-V and Civic also frequently need attention for variable valve timing (VVT) actuator issues, which can cause a rattling noise on cold starts.

Seek immediate service if you notice signs of cooling system failure, like overheating, as our summer heat strains engines. Also, address any check engine lights promptly, as issues like faulty oxygen sensors can reduce fuel efficiency, and with long commutes common here, this quickly increases costs.
The frequent use of road salt in winter necessitates more frequent undercarriage washes and vigilant checks for rust. Additionally, the mix of highway driving and rough back roads means you should have your alignment, shocks, and struts inspected more often than the manual's standard schedule suggests.
